Cultivating love can lead to a more compassionate and connected world from "summary" of Love 2.0 by Barbara L. Fredrickson,Ph.D.
Barbara L. Fredrickson and Ph. D. in their book 'Love 2.0' explore the transformative power of love in fostering compassion and connection on a global scale. They argue that by cultivating love in our daily interactions, we can create a ripple effect that spreads kindness and understanding throughout the world. According to Fredrickson, love is not just limited to romantic relationships or familial bonds. Instead, she defines love as a momentary connection that arises from shared positive emotions.
